Democrat Flips Palm Beach Mar-a-Lago District in Florida Special Election

TL;DR Summary
Democrat Emily Gregory won a Florida special election in a Palm Beach district that includes Mar-a-Lago, flipping the seat from Republican Mike Caruso who resigned to become Palm Beach County clerk; she defeated Trump-endorsed rival Jon Maples by about 2.4 percentage points, a win Democrats touted as momentum ahead of the midterms.
